Commit graph

  • 76d3779438 Moved GroupUpdateMessage to protobuf David Négrier 2020-09-21 11:24:03 +02:00
  • 8b46753c7d
    Merge pull request #279 from thecodingmachine/tokenRegister Kharhamel 2020-09-21 11:02:43 +02:00
  • a19f09bef2 improve the register workflow arp 2020-09-18 16:29:53 +02:00
  • 16b3e48711 Add menu to switch Gregoire Parant 2020-09-21 01:16:10 +02:00
  • 1829912c91 Fix remove last childnode Gregoire Parant 2020-09-21 00:42:39 +02:00
  • e0ae79eaf1 Fini quill box Gregoire Parant 2020-09-21 00:34:25 +02:00
  • 9b955ebd20 fix style quill box Gregoire Parant 2020-09-20 19:31:24 +02:00
  • 844bffa988 Create file controller to upload audio document Gregoire Parant 2020-09-20 19:01:21 +02:00
  • 45ad4bbb36 Send and play audio message Gregoire Parant 2020-09-20 17:12:27 +02:00
  • 4c7e458e52 create event and brodcast event in backend Gregoire Parant 2020-09-19 01:08:56 +02:00
  • 57545a96a5 Removing binary call because missing typescript def David Négrier 2020-09-18 18:18:39 +02:00
  • b148ca3708 Linting David Négrier 2020-09-18 18:16:26 +02:00
  • 5c63573ef1 Adding protoc to CI David Négrier 2020-09-18 18:01:36 +02:00
  • d2a5060ad2 Using multistage builds with protocol buffers David Négrier 2020-09-18 18:00:03 +02:00
  • d3116c7400 Building proto messages in CI David Négrier 2020-09-18 17:51:12 +02:00
  • 398ca1760b Fixing CI builds David Négrier 2020-09-18 17:47:18 +02:00
  • 5c0a4e7c5a Fixing front Dockerfile David Négrier 2020-09-18 17:39:59 +02:00
  • 30d2a25501 Artillery cleanup David Négrier 2020-09-18 17:36:33 +02:00
  • 7826b2ea8d Fixing Docker build images to add new messages directory David Négrier 2020-09-18 17:18:50 +02:00
  • 32f92d5c45 Switching test loading from Artillery to home-grown test David Négrier 2020-09-18 17:01:45 +02:00
  • 28dc3a2c84 Removing protobuf packages from back David Négrier 2020-09-18 16:05:52 +02:00
  • df0636c513 Migrating user position messages to protobuf David Négrier 2020-09-18 15:51:15 +02:00
  • 3a17795ad3 added basic token auth arp 2020-09-18 15:48:30 +02:00
  • e9ca8721a6 Migrating userId to "int32" to save some space and adding userMoves message in protobuf David Négrier 2020-09-18 13:57:38 +02:00
  • ed9552b62b added a register route via token arp 2020-09-17 18:08:20 +02:00
  • 4b55b54a07 Adding first protobuf message exchange David Négrier 2020-09-17 17:14:47 +02:00
  • 9dd3d4bac8 Watching protoc in dev mode David Négrier 2020-09-16 22:27:37 +02:00
  • e59cbcfaa7 Create console global message Gregoire Parant 2020-09-16 21:50:04 +02:00
  • 509196785b Initialise global message Gregoire Parant 2020-09-16 18:38:50 +02:00
  • 2e8fa8d676 Adding protocol buffers to the project with Typescript support David Négrier 2020-09-16 18:34:24 +02:00
  • 8e07fc6513 Adding default Jitsi in env.template groups_in_zones David Négrier 2020-09-16 17:09:34 +02:00
  • c4a0f2f1a4 Fixing URL for room in Artilery David Négrier 2020-09-16 16:59:09 +02:00
  • 1ccbea30e4
    Merge pull request #277 from thecodingmachine/groups_in_zones David Négrier 2020-09-16 16:50:13 +02:00
  • f6458a8335 Removing useless group callbacks at the World level David Négrier 2020-09-16 16:13:47 +02:00
  • 7410cc8a4b Fixing tests David Négrier 2020-09-16 16:10:20 +02:00
  • f5f9dcac04 Making groups part of zones David Négrier 2020-09-16 16:06:43 +02:00
  • 3ca2a5bf68
    Merge pull request #227 from thecodingmachine/outline David Négrier 2020-09-16 12:10:39 +02:00
  • 3a9196fb82 Merge David Négrier 2020-09-16 11:41:03 +02:00
  • 30e15fbcab
    Merge pull request #273 from thecodingmachine/viewport_sharing David Négrier 2020-09-16 11:25:49 +02:00
  • 7e7b42ce19 Changing load test to run in circles David Négrier 2020-09-16 09:31:44 +02:00
  • d24ec0bd75 Plugin PositionNotifier into the main application. David Négrier 2020-09-15 16:21:41 +02:00
  • f8d462b0d7 Fixing "any" type David Négrier 2020-09-15 10:10:35 +02:00
  • 9b702c75e3 Adding batched messages + the notion of notifier / zones (not plugged in the system yet) David Négrier 2020-09-15 10:06:11 +02:00
  • 1879c550c4 Merge branch 'master' of github.com:thecodingmachine/workadventure into develop David Négrier 2020-09-11 13:42:07 +02:00
  • 483bb9de3a
    Merge pull request #269 from thecodingmachine/simulate-player David Négrier 2020-09-11 13:40:44 +02:00
  • f55fa76e86 Removing profiling mode David Négrier 2020-09-11 10:01:45 +02:00
  • b37a8f63be Moved benchmark to its own directory and added multicore testing + a README David Négrier 2020-09-11 09:56:05 +02:00
  • 762f4da905
    Merge pull request #268 from thecodingmachine/modebuttonsdepth David Négrier 2020-09-10 09:43:33 +02:00
  • e418e8fd09 Setting the depth of the chat mode / presentation mode to 99999 to avoid melting buttons with map. David Négrier 2020-09-10 09:31:53 +02:00
  • d4fe59d154 Create config file artillery websocket Gregoire Parant 2020-09-09 12:32:01 +02:00
  • 2e2e50f7c3
    Merge pull request #259 from thecodingmachine/develop David Négrier 2020-09-02 09:05:23 +02:00
  • 4226453364
    Merge pull request #258 from thecodingmachine/hidecamonjistsi David Négrier 2020-09-01 15:08:40 +02:00
  • f70ba1411a Hiding cam details when entering a Jisti room David Négrier 2020-09-01 14:43:21 +02:00
  • f0497f2d55
    Merge pull request #256 from thecodingmachine/develop David Négrier 2020-09-01 14:24:10 +02:00
  • 0df6f78e6b
    Merge pull request #255 from thecodingmachine/fixcowebsitecentering David Négrier 2020-09-01 14:15:33 +02:00
  • 9516f6615c Centering character based on game div David Négrier 2020-08-31 17:56:11 +02:00
  • 7f980bd2e9
    Merge pull request #252 from thecodingmachine/develop David Négrier 2020-08-31 16:29:32 +02:00
  • 1ed132145c
    Merge pull request #244 from thecodingmachine/turnserver David Négrier 2020-08-31 16:01:35 +02:00
  • b6590e21dd Fixing coturn URLS David Négrier 2020-08-28 17:30:33 +02:00
  • 8655aef629 Fixing URL passing in WebRtc setup David Négrier 2020-08-28 16:29:21 +02:00
  • 3875c0afe8 Fixing environment variable passing in Webpack David Négrier 2020-08-28 16:18:26 +02:00
  • ed116cf2a3 Switching on our very own turn server David Négrier 2020-08-28 13:52:25 +02:00
  • 6f6873e870
    Merge pull request #251 from thecodingmachine/fix_camera_stop David Négrier 2020-08-31 15:31:33 +02:00
  • 634eecd42a Fixing issue when both mic and cam are stopped David Négrier 2020-08-31 15:21:05 +02:00
  • c739037bc4 Camera was not properly closed in EnableCameraScene David Négrier 2020-08-31 14:54:52 +02:00
  • 69fad27328
    Merge pull request #247 from thecodingmachine/act_on_zone David Négrier 2020-08-31 14:30:25 +02:00
  • 8968627d69 Adding Jitsi meeting in TCM maps David Négrier 2020-08-31 14:23:31 +02:00
  • 9351719873 Adding the notion of silent zone David Négrier 2020-08-31 14:10:01 +02:00
  • df7b5cc2e3 Adding a "silent" notion (triggered in Jitsi meets) David Négrier 2020-08-31 14:03:40 +02:00
  • 0a8ba37049 Adding Jitsi meet support David Négrier 2020-08-31 12:18:00 +02:00
  • a128ff117b code style David Négrier 2020-08-30 17:40:04 +02:00
  • 01319b50ca Adding a "openWebsite" property that opens websites when we walk over the zone. David Négrier 2020-08-30 17:37:38 +02:00
  • 168697eb46 Adding a GameMap class that helps tracking when the properties of the tiles the user is changes (when the user moves) David Négrier 2020-08-30 15:44:22 +02:00
  • 4d90d4b50b
    Merge pull request #243 from thecodingmachine/zoom_on_video David Négrier 2020-08-27 10:26:02 +02:00
  • 13272968cf Clicking on a video puts it in presentation mode David Négrier 2020-08-27 10:09:47 +02:00
  • 15e7b88e2b
    Merge pull request #242 from thecodingmachine/screenshare2 David Négrier 2020-08-24 18:30:20 +02:00
  • 7dc9e32b84 Merge branch 'screenshare2' into outline David Négrier 2020-08-24 18:24:47 +02:00
  • 7f5f802b86 Avoiding flickering when entering presentation mode with no presentation David Négrier 2020-08-24 18:23:02 +02:00
  • fca93663b4 Merge branch 'develop' of github.com:thecodingmachine/workadventure into outline David Négrier 2020-08-24 18:15:44 +02:00
  • 623a87c8ea
    Merge pull request #241 from thecodingmachine/screenshare2 David Négrier 2020-08-24 14:28:52 +02:00
  • 044495cf05 Centering character in free space David Négrier 2020-08-24 14:19:36 +02:00
  • 641175a77c
    Merge pull request #240 from thecodingmachine/screenshare2 David Négrier 2020-08-22 15:37:32 +02:00
  • b7c2f8be7b Adding colors for cam/mic/screen share button David Négrier 2020-08-22 15:26:40 +02:00
  • 87dd889e25
    Merge pull request #239 from thecodingmachine/screenshare2 David Négrier 2020-08-21 23:16:28 +02:00
  • 91f422d0c3 Fixing stop of stream in bi-directional screen sharing. David Négrier 2020-08-21 22:53:17 +02:00
  • f60b02f1dc Putting a wider onhover surface when clicking on one of the buttons to manage screen sharing or video/mic David Négrier 2020-08-20 22:57:34 +02:00
  • 2ae19b9f30 Fixing build David Négrier 2020-08-20 22:34:50 +02:00
  • c442d6ce67 Lint David Négrier 2020-08-20 22:29:14 +02:00
  • dc36af19bc Detecting press on "stop screen sharing" David Négrier 2020-08-20 22:23:38 +02:00
  • 1162439479 Overloading destroy method instead of having a separate method to remove video. David Négrier 2020-08-20 22:23:22 +02:00
  • 27ffb6b13d Refactoring SimplePeer code: splitting Peer instantiation into 2 subclasses (VideoPeer and ScreenSharingPeer). This leads to way leaner code. David Négrier 2020-08-20 16:56:10 +02:00
  • 894f7c8009 Removing useless roomID parameter in WebRtcSignal message David Négrier 2020-08-20 15:21:07 +02:00
  • 0119534283 First version of screen-sharing that works when a user is joining a group after screen sharing begun. David Négrier 2020-08-20 00:05:00 +02:00
  • 6c5772e849 Fixing typipng in back David Négrier 2020-08-18 15:31:42 +02:00
  • cc1cb2f671 Fixing linting David Négrier 2020-08-18 14:59:50 +02:00
  • 2e61c2ef62 Getting back code in compilable fashion after huge rebase David Négrier 2020-08-18 00:12:38 +02:00
  • 4b72958193 Fix peer connexion for two player with screen sharing Gregoire Parant 2020-06-14 20:53:18 +02:00
  • a8f27e6084 Create event to start webrtc screen charing Gregoire Parant 2020-06-14 14:47:16 +02:00
  • a4f42111d7 Update screen sharing feature Gregoire Parant 2020-06-11 23:18:06 +02:00
  • 0bbed7717a Continue screen sharing Gregoire Parant 2020-06-08 22:52:25 +02:00